STERLING
Sterling is about 7 years old and ended up in a VA pound when
his owner died. This poor guy must have lived a life full of
hardships. When he was pulled from the shelter, he was scared
but oh so friendly! His first expression was: "thank you for
getting me out of this jail". Sterling has one of the most
beautiful, gentle faces. He has a crystal blue eye and the
other is brown. He is very underweight from his stay at the
pound, but with love, good food, and attention, this guy will
fill out and look great. Enough cannot be said about his fabulous
temperment - he is now living in a foster home with 9 other
Dals and he is the mellow one! He seldom barks except to go
out, he is not destructive, and he is crate/house trained.
Sterling is a dog that has the potential to be a pet therapy
dog because he seems to sense that small children, physically
challenged people, etc., need his special gentle touch.
Sterling carries with him a scar. On the back of his rump
there is an area where all the fur is gone and just scar
tissue remains. After being examined by the vets, the theory
is that this wonderful dog was burned very badly. No one knows
if this was intentional, but one thing is for sure, Sterling
suffered a horrible situation. Yet, no one would know from
his kind manner. If there was only one word to describe
Sterling it would be that he is an Angel.
